Job description

Responsible for ensuring delivery of an educational programme, developing loyalty from existing customers by delivering excellence in everything. As part of this role the FE Sports Teacher will be involved in working with learners on a group or on a one-to-one basis, delivering all aspects of qualification.

-Teaching/Learner Management

  • Identify and progress new topic areas, courses and teaching materials whilst maintaining up-to-date subject knowledge
  • Lead, inspire and support learners with different abilities
  • Mark work, giving appropriate feedback and maintain records of learners’ progress and development
  • Manage and monitor all learner evidence in line with company and awarding body requirements
  • Devise and oversee examinations, ensure regular contact with the Quality Trainer (IV) to ensure quality standards are met
  • Ensure all learners are progress through their qualification adhering to schemes of work
  • Maintain regular communication with Key Stakeholders on learner progress
  • Carry out a pastoral role as a personal tutor to learners
  • Identify and plan additional support for learners as necessary
  • Act as a Company representative at parents' evenings, taster days, open days and careers or education conventions
  • Interview potential learners and conduct assessments as necessary
  • Manage learner behaviour and apply appropriate and effective measures in cases of unacceptable behaviour;
  • Establish work experience and carry out learner assessments in the workplace, as appropriate
  • Ensure Equality and Diversity is embedded and instilled both in and out of the classroom
  • Identify and raise any safeguarding issues to the relevant representative
  • Promote and instil a safe learning environment

ESSENTIAL

  • A recognised secondary or post 16 teaching qualification, e.g. PGCE, PTLLS or A1 Award
  • Minimum of a level 3 qualification within a related subject area.
  • First Aid

DESIRABLE

  • Assessors Award
  • Verifiers Award
  • Safeguarding
